An exciting opportunity has arisen in Nevill Hall hospital and The Royal Gwent Hospital, with inpatient sessions undertaken in Grange University hospital, the new state of the art specialist and critical care centre for Aneurin Bevan University Health Board that opened in November 2020. You could be joining an enthusiastic, vibrant team during an ambitious reconfiguration of gastroenterology services, taking account of the new centralisation of inpatient services. There is support to increase the consultant workforce with a further substantive position based in Royal Gwent Hospital and ongoing expansion across the Health Board anticipated in the next two years. We welcome applicants with a luminal gastroenterology specialty interest and a desire to work flexibly to maintain work-life balance.
The Health Board actively supports consultant doctors to undertake funded 3 month formal sabbaticals through an annual application process.

This position involves Regulated Activity with adults as defined by the Safeguarding Vulnerable Groups Act (amended by the Protection of Freedoms Act 2012) and the following checks will be undertaken following any conditional offer:
- Enhanced check with barred list information, including
- - an adults and children’s barred list check
Applicants must hold full registration and a licence to practice with the GMC
Candidates for Consultant posts must also be on the GMC Specialist Register (including via CESR/European Community Rights) or will have a CCT/CESR(CP) date within 6 months of interview.
